Design of refractory materials for furnace wall and furnace bottom of electric arc furnace.

The working conditions of the furnace wall and furnace bottom are roughly the same as those of the furnace cover. 

They are susceptible to the high temperature radiation of the arc. They work under extremely high temperature conditions and are often subjected to quenching.

More serious than the furnace cover is that the furnace wall and furnace bottom are directly contacted with molten steel and slag, and are eroded by molten steel and slag, and are also impacted by the charge when charging.

Therefore, it's very important to choose high-quality refractory materials, especially the parts in contact with the slag and the parts close to the arc hot spot have higher requirements. 


The Commonly Used Refractory Materials Are As Follows:

① Magnesia

Magnesia is one of the main materials for building the lining of alkaline electric arc furnaces. It's used to knot the bottom and slope of the furnace, and can also be used to make magnesia bricks.

At the same time, it is the main material for furnace repair.

Magnesia is calcined from natural magnesite at a temperature of 1650°C.

The refractoriness of magnesia can reach above 2000 ℃, and it has better ability to resist the erosion of basic slag.

However, its thermal stability is poor and its thermal conductivity is large. The main component of magnesia is magnesium oxide> 85%, and also contains a small amount of impurities.

② Dolomite

Dolomite is also one of the main materials for the lining of alkaline electric arc furnaces. 

It's used as furnace wall and furnace repair material, and can also be made into dolomite bricks.

The refractoriness of dolomite is also above 2000°C, it can resist the erosion of alkaline slag, and its thermal stability is better than that of magnesia, but dolomite is easy to absorb water and pulverize.

Therefore, the time from firing to use of dolomite should be shortened as much as possible.

③ Quartz Sand

Quartz sand is one of the main materials for the lining of acid electric arc furnaces.

Pure quartz sand is a crystal transparent body. It is white when it contains a small amount of florets. The more florets are, the darker it becomes. 

The quartz sand used in electric arc furnaces is mostly white.

④ Various Refractory Masonry

Clay is mainly used as a refractory material for the furnace wall and furnace bottom of the electric arc furnace, so the refractoriness and the softening temperature under load are low, and it is used as an insulating brick inside, which is built near the furnace shell.

In the clay bricks, magnesia bricks and other alkaline bricks are built again.

Due to the lack of raw materials, magnesia-alumina bricks are more expensive and less used. 

Silica bricks are used in acid electric arc furnaces.
